Output 06faf8a24aeb912289a583b27db2c9993b4752fba758aabf339bb37523a1dc7e:1

value
37913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85bef3dac47c952a0029142a3dd9bef0a8944dd0 OP_EQUAL
address
3DtCYg1jXKfVbEa2f5m2FwT7cMezzDL4rh
transaction
06faf8a24aeb912289a583b27db2c9993b4752fba758aabf339bb37523a1dc7e
spent
true